Abstract

A shaft (6) extends through the body (1). The shaft is driven for rotation and/or oscillation by a motor at its end, so that a blade (8) fitted at the shaft other end, via a hand grip (10), is moved axially in relation to the body, imparting a rotation movement for carrying out the operative engagement. The shaft is electrically insulated from the body so that electrical current can be fed through the shaft to the blade to allow cutting and stop bleeding. A safety switch is incorporated. The shaft-driving motor (9), which can be electric, pneumatic or hydraulic, is fitted in direct connection with the tubular body or connected with it by means of a flexible shaft. An electronic safety circuit stops the motor when bleeding occurs.

Extending centrally through the body 1 is a shaft 6, which at its end part 7 extending from the end of the body 1 carries a cutting tool, namely a knife in the form of a shackle 8. At its other end, the shaft 6 according to that shown in fig. 1 shows an engine 9, on the mantle of which a handle 10 is attached. This surgical tool works so that when the body 1 is inserted through the urethra so far that the knife 8 is at the prostate, the engine 9 is started. The shaft 6 is then caused to rotate and in turn imparts a rotating movement to the knife 8 in order to cut off a layer of the prostate. By means of the handle 10, the motor 9 with the shaft 6 and the knife 8 can be displaced in the indicated manner, whereby tissue is removed along the entire prostate gland. This sliding movement in the sleeve means that rubbing with the sleeve against sensitive tissue is avoided. Here it is illustrated how, in order to prevent too deep cutting, a safety switch 11 has been arranged, which detects whether the knife 8 should sink to an unacceptable depth. In such a case, the end of the body 1 will be lowered so that the shackle 11, i.e. the safety switch, pivots around its pivot point 12 and acts on a contact means 13 to cut off the current to the motor 9 and thus interrupt the cutting of the prostate.
